
High Grinding Efficiency: Abrasive mesh offers effective and rapid material removal, efficiently smoothing out surfaces.
Even Grinding: The mesh structure provides uniform sanding, reducing unevenness and ensuring consistent results.
Anti-Clogging: The design resists clogging by preventing abrasive particles and dust from obstructing the surface, maintaining optimal performance.
Durable: Abrasive mesh is generally more durable than traditional sandpaper, allowing for extended use with less frequent replacements.
Good Airflow: The mesh design allows for excellent airflow, aiding in heat dissipation and dust removal, enhancing comfort and efficiency during use.
Versatile: It can be used on a variety of materials, including wood, metal, and plastic, and is suitable for different shapes and surface preparation needs.
Easy to Clean: The mesh surface is relatively easy to clean, often requiring just brushing or blowing to remove dust and debris, restoring its grinding effectiveness.
High Flexibility: Abrasive mesh is flexible and can adapt to different shapes and contours, making it ideal for working on complex or irregular surfaces.
Environmental Benefits: Due to its durability and extended lifespan, abrasive mesh generates less waste compared to traditional sandpaper, contributing to environmental sustainability.
Woodworking: Used for sanding and smoothing wood surfaces, including removing old finishes and preparing surfaces for painting or staining.
Metalworking: Applied in the finishing and polishing of metal surfaces, including removing rust, oxidation, and weld marks.
Automotive Refinishing: Ideal for preparing automotive surfaces for painting, removing imperfections, and smoothing bodywork before applying coatings.
Plastic Processing: Utilized for sanding and shaping plastic components, including removing mold lines and achieving a smooth finish.
Drywall Sanding: Employed to smooth out drywall seams and joint compounds, preparing walls for painting or wallpapering.
Marine Maintenance: Used for cleaning and preparing surfaces on boats and marine equipment, including removing marine growth and preparing surfaces for painting.
Glass Surface Preparation: Applied in the processing of glass surfaces, including edge finishing and preparation for further treatment or coating.
Composite Materials: Effective for sanding and finishing composite materials, including fiberglass and carbon fiber, to achieve a smooth and even surface.
Stone and Concrete: Used for surface preparation and finishing of stone and concrete surfaces, including removing imperfections and achieving a polished look.
Furniture Restoration: Ideal for refurbishing and restoring furniture surfaces, including removing old finishes and preparing wood for new coatings.
